Guidance on Best Practices for Using Agents Across Microsoft Platforms

Nalini Bhavaraju 110 Reputation points
2025-12-09T17:13:15.1466667+00:00

Hi Team,

I’m looking for guidance on how to best leverage the different types of AI agents available across the Microsoft ecosystem — specifically Power Automate, Copilot (including Copilot Studio), and Azure OpenAI–based agents - for food manufacturing Firm.

Our goal is to understand:

The recommended approach for building agents that can interact with Power BI dashboards, analyze data, and provide insights or raise questions for end users.

The differences in capabilities, limitations, and ideal use cases for each agent type.

Any best practices or architectural recommendations for selecting the right agent framework within the Microsoft umbrella.

Could you please provide direction or reference documentation on how enterprises typically utilize these agents and which patterns Microsoft recommends?

Microsoft Copilot | Other
0 comments No comments
{count} votes

1 answer

Sort by: Most helpful
  1. Q&A Assist
    2025-12-09T17:13:29.3166667+00:00
    AI generated content. This question contains an answer created with AI from Q&A Assist. Learn more

    To effectively leverage AI agents across the Microsoft ecosystem for a food manufacturing firm, consider the following guidance:

    1. Integration with Power BI: Utilize agents that can interact with Power BI dashboards. This can be achieved through Power Automate, which allows for automation of workflows and can trigger actions based on data changes in Power BI. Additionally, Copilot can assist in generating insights from the data visualizations and analytics provided by Power BI.
    2. Data Analysis and Insights: For analyzing data and providing insights, consider using Azure OpenAI-based agents. These agents can process large datasets and generate natural language responses to queries, making them suitable for providing insights or raising questions based on the data.

    Differences in Capabilities and Ideal Use Cases

    • Power Automate Agents: Best suited for automating repetitive tasks and workflows. They can connect various Microsoft services and external applications, making them ideal for operational processes in food manufacturing.
    • Copilot Agents: These agents are designed to assist users in generating content and insights. They can be particularly useful for creating reports or summarizing data findings from Power BI.
    • Azure OpenAI-based Agents: These agents excel in natural language processing and can handle complex queries, making them ideal for scenarios requiring detailed analysis and conversational interactions with users.

    Best Practices and Architectural Recommendations

    • Selecting the Right Framework: Start by assessing the specific needs of your use case. If the focus is on automation, Power Automate is the best choice. For generating insights and content, leverage Copilot. For advanced data analysis and conversational capabilities, consider Azure OpenAI agents.
    • Architectural Considerations: Ensure that your architecture supports seamless integration between these agents. Utilize Dataverse for centralized data management and consider implementing row-level security to protect sensitive information.
    • Monitoring and Optimization: Regularly track agent performance and user interactions to refine their capabilities and improve user experience. Use Power BI to visualize agent performance metrics and make data-driven adjustments.

    By following these guidelines, your firm can effectively utilize Microsoft’s AI agents to enhance operational efficiency and data-driven decision-making.


    References:

    0 comments No comments

Your answer

Answers can be marked as 'Accepted' by the question author and 'Recommended' by moderators, which helps users know the answer solved the author's problem.